Single missed payment strips US man of health coverage, forces treatment cancellation

A North Carolina man's medical treatment was derailed after a single missed insurance payment resulted in the immediate cancellation of his health coverage, underscoring the stringent policies governing healthcare access in the United States.

The uninsured resident faced a difficult choice between resuming premium payments and proceeding with essential medical care, ultimately deciding to forgo treatment due to financial constraints. The situation reflects broader concerns about the fragility of America's employment-based health insurance system, where lapses in payment can swiftly terminate coverage.

Health insurance providers in the US typically enforce strict payment deadlines, with many policies allowing minimal grace periods before cancellation. Patients who lose coverage unexpectedly often face substantial out-of-pocket costs for ongoing medical treatment, forcing difficult decisions about whether to continue care.

The incident comes as healthcare affordability remains a contentious issue in American policy debates. Critics argue that the current system places vulnerable populations at risk, as unexpected job loss, financial hardship, or administrative oversights can result in sudden coverage termination.

Experts recommend that individuals maintain awareness of payment deadlines and explore alternative coverage options, including government-subsidized programs, to prevent similar situations.
